Always sit with a straight spine and a relaxed body. For all pranayama (except Kapalabhati), the breath is slow and steady, breathed in and out of the nose and down into the belly. Prana is taken in through the air we breathe, and since the pranayama exercises increase the amount of air we take in, they also increase our intake of Prana. Thus, Pranyama is used to control, cultivate, and modify the Prana in the body. Prana translates into “life force energy” and Yama translates into “control or mastery of”. How long did it take to fill the pool with water?Ībout two days (not filling overnight). How long did it take to assemble the pool?Īccording to Karel, the assembly itself was pretty quick. He also added a few flat pieces of wood under the pool legs to help spread the weight load so it wouldn't dig into the softer ground (the ground is pretty sturdy but soft in terms of the heavy pool). Lastly, he purchased an outdoor green "carpet" to use as a smooth/sturdy base on top of the soil. He also purchased and used a long 2 x 4 piece of wood to put a level on to help with leveling the ground. He purchased some gardening/digging tools for this process. He removed the sod and dug to create a smooth base level for the pool. ![]() Because we wanted the pool on the side of our house where the yard slightly slopes down, Karel has to even the surface of the ground. When coming from group policy, configuring lock screen image and desktop wallpaper, this is respectively done for the computer (computer configuration) and the user (user configuration), and would typically require 2 Group Policy objects (unless mixing user and computer configurations, but that’d be a mess in my opinion).
